}
};
+
+for (var key in mkws_config) {
+ if (mkws_config.hasOwnProperty(key)) {
+ if (key.match(/^language_/)) {
+ var lang = key.replace(/^language_/, "");
+ // Copy custom languages into list
+ mkws_locale_lang[lang] = mkws_config[key];
+ }
+ }
+}
+
+
// create a parameters array and pass it to the pz2's constructor
// then register the form submit event with the pz2.search function
// autoInit is set to true on default
function switchView(view) {
var targets = document.getElementById('mkwsTargets');
- var results = document.getElementById('mkwsResults');
- var records = document.getElementById('mkwsRecords');
+ var results = document.getElementById('mkwsResults') ||
+ document.getElementById('mkwsRecords');
var blanket = document.getElementById('mkwsBlanket');
switch(view) {
case 'targets':
if (targets) targets.style.display = "block";
- if (results) {
- results.style.display = "none";
- } else {
- records.style.display = "none";
- }
+ if (results) results.style.display = "none";
if (blanket) blanket.style.display = "none";
break;
case 'records':
if (targets) targets.style.display = "none";
- if (results) {
- results.style.display = "block";
- } else {
- records.style.display = "block";
- }
+ if (results) results.style.display = "block";
if (blanket) blanket.style.display = "block";
break;
case 'none':
if (targets) targets.style.display = "none";
- if (results) {
- results.style.display = "none";
- } else {
- records.style.display = "none";
- }
+ if (results) results.style.display = "none";
if (blanket) blanket.style.display = "none";
break;
default:
$("#mkwsSwitch").html($("<a/>", {
href: '#',
onclick: "switchView(\'records\')",
- text: "Records"
+ text: M("Records")
}));
$("#mkwsSwitch").append($("<span/>", { text: " | " }));
$("#mkwsSwitch").append($("<a/>", {
href: '#',
onclick: "switchView(\'targets\')",
- text: "Targets"
+ text: M("Targets")
}));
debug("HTML targets");